Why does my floor in Trabuco Highlands feel dry but your meter says it's wet?
A 'dry to the touch' surface can still have damaging moisture trapped within the material. We follow the IICRC S500 psychrometric standard, which requires drying to an equilibrium of 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F for this region. This measures vapor pressure within the material, not just surface moisture. Failing to meet this GPP standard leads to hidden wicking, microbial growth, and structural compromise.

My insurance says it's 'clean water' from a supply line. What does that mean for my claim?
A Category 1 'clean water' claim originates from a sanitary source like a supply line or tub overflow. This classification simplifies the restoration process versus Category 3 'black water' from sewage or flooding. How quickly must I act on a water leak to prevent mold?
The documented microbial growth window is 48-72 hours from the initial intrusion. In 2026, insurance carriers and liability standards have shifted. If documented mitigation does not begin within this 72-hour window, a standard Category 1 'clean water' loss can be reclassified as a Category 2 or 3 'grey/black water' loss, significantly increasing claim complexity and potentially voiding coverage for resulting microbial growth.
